Background
Aaron Paul Waxman is a Partner at Cerity Partners based in San Francisco, where he provides comprehensive investment and planning advice to high-net-worth individuals. He specializes in working with multigenerational families, business executives, and entrepreneurs with complex income and estate tax planning needs. The email address [hidden] references the legacy domain of Bingham, Osborn & Scarborough (B|O|S), which merged with Cerity Partners in Q2 2022.
Aaron earned his Bachelor of Science in Finance from Santa Clara University. After graduating, he began his career at P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P, where he worked as a Manager in the Private Client Services Group, advising high-net-worth clients on tax and financial planning strategies. This foundation in accounting and tax advisory equipped him with deep technical expertise in wealth structuring and estate planning.
He later joined Bingham, Osborn & Scarborough (B|O|S), a prestigious San Francisco-based registered investment advisor founded in 1976. At B|O|S, Aaron rose to become a Principal and was appointed to the firm's Board of Managers, where he played a strategic role in firm-wide initiatives and day-to-day operations. In 2018, B|O|S management, including Aaron, led a transaction to buy back majority ownership from Boston Private Financial Holdings, regaining independence with approximately 68% ownership held by principals and founders. In 2022, B|O|S merged with Cerity Partners, a leading national wealth management firm, and Aaron continues as a Partner in the combined organization.
Aaron holds both the Certified Public Accountant (CPA) and C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ER® (CFP®) designations, as well as a Series 65 license. He is recognized as one of the San Francisco Bay Area's top wealth advisors, combining technical tax expertise with personalized investment guidance.
